South Korea’s SK Hynix has entered the trillion-dollar market capitalization club, a landmark driven by the explosive growth of artificial intelligence, Nikkei Asia reports. The company, a leading manufacturer of memory chips, has seen its stock price climb sharply as demand for High Bandwidth Memory (HBM) – a critical component in AI graphics processing units – accelerates. This surge reflects a broader trend across East Asian equities, where semiconductor-related stocks have outperformed amid a global AI investment wave. Alongside SK Hynix,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company (TSMC) and Samsung Electronics have also experienced notable gains, benefiting from their roles in the AI supply chain. The report indicates that investor expectations for continued AI adoption and chip demand are fueling these moves, though market participants remain watchful of potential supply constraints and geopolitical risks. The milestone marks a significant achievement for SK Hynix, which has invested heavily in HBM production capacity and research to meet customer needs from major AI firms. The key takeaway from this development is the deepening link between AI infrastructure spending and semiconductor market valuations. SK Hynix’s entry into the trillion-dollar club suggests that investors are pricing in sustained demand for memory chips tailored to AI workloads, not just for training but increasingly for inference. This trend could also support other memory manufacturers and related suppliers across the region, as the AI ecosystem expands. However, the rally also highlights concentration risk, as gains are heavily tied to a few companies exposed to AI. Geopolitical tensions and potential export controls on advanced chips remain factors that may affect future performance. Additionally, any slowdown in AI investment from major cloud providers could moderate the growth trajectory for these stocks. The market’s reaction indicates that near-term optimism for AI-driven earnings is high, but valuation levels may warrant cautious monitoring. From an investment perspective, SK Hynix’s achievement reinforces the narrative that AI remains a powerful catalyst for semiconductor companies. The company’s leadership in HBM positions it well to capture value from the AI revolution, though the cyclical nature of the memory industry introduces volatility. Investors may consider the potential for continued revenue growth against risks such as oversupply, technological shifts, or changes in customer demand. The broader East Asian stock rally also reflects a preference for AI-related plays over other sectors, which could lead to a bifurcated market. While the long-term outlook for AI appears constructive, near-term price movements may be influenced by earnings reports, product announcements, and macroeconomic conditions.
